Output 6666c33255023ae64b211d369dd793bfd7d8d6b6124c42959b170562008d987a:5
- value
- 28432686
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e1f2afa1db2447152771daea3a22e89c42d6e091 OP_EQUAL
- address
- 3NHigq2gHPrBzgSdxMy37NbbTurwX2kacN
- transaction
- 6666c33255023ae64b211d369dd793bfd7d8d6b6124c42959b170562008d987a